The fifty euro note is the fourth smallest note, measuring 140 millimetres (5.5 in) 77 millimetres (3.0 in), with an orange colour scheme. Estimates suggest that the average life of a euro banknote is about three years before it is replaced due to wear, but individual lifespans vary depending on denomination, from less than a year for 5 banknote to over 30 years for 500 banknote. The two hundred euro note (200) is the second-highest value euro banknote (and the highest value banknote in production) and has been used since the introduction of the euro (in its cash form) in 2002. A fresh look was given to the banknotes in 2013 to include more up-to-date security features, including a watermark portrait of the Greek goddess Europa, although the original ages and styles theme remained.
